Saudi Arabia sees 3% lower salaries for Saudi nationals in Q3-20

Riyadh - Mubasher: Saudi Arabia recorded a 3% drop in the average monthly salaries paid to Saudi citizens to SAR 9,971 during the third quarter (Q3) of 2020, compared to SAR 10,273 in the same period of 2019.

The average monthly salaries for Saudi men declined by 1.02% in Q3-20, compared to SAR 10,487 in the corresponding period of 2019, according to data collected by Mubasher based on the latest official figures.

Meanwhile, Saudi women's average monthly payments retreated by 8% in the July-September period of 2020 from SAR 9,443 in the year-ago period.

As for the expatriates in Saudi Arabia, the average monthly salaries rose by 9% to SAR 4,213 in Q3-20 from SAR 3,866 in the same period of the earlier year.

In addition, Saudi citizens working in the public sector received an average monthly salary of SAR 11,230 in the July-September period of 2020, down 2.4% from SAR 11,505 in the same period of 2019.

The average monthly salaries for the expatriates working in Saudi Arabia's public sector jumped by 5.8% to around SAR 10,360 in Q3-20 from SAR 9,798 in the year-ago period.

In the private sector, the salaries of Saudis recorded SAR 7,455 in Q3-20, about 5% higher than SAR 7,104 in Q3-19.

The average salaries of expats working in the private sector increased by 14.2% to SAR 4,655 by the end of the third quarter of 2020 from SAR 4,077 in the same quarter of 2019.
